<?php
namespace Tests\E2E\Services\Project;
use PHPUnit\Framework\Attributes\Before;
use PHPUnit\Framework\Attributes\DataProvider;
use Tests\E2E\Client;
use Utopia\Database\Query;
trait OAuth2Base
{
/**
* Reset providers we mutate in tests back to a known empty/disabled state.
* The ProjectCustom trait reuses the same project across tests in a class,
* and the OAuth2 PATCH endpoint is additive (omitted fields are preserved),
* so without a reset state would leak between tests.
*
* Assert on the reset response so a silently broken reset (e.g. validation
* change) surfaces immediately rather than corrupting downstream tests.
*/
#[Before(priority: -1)]
protected function resetProjectOAuth2(): void
{
$response = $this->updateOAuth2('amazon', [
'clientId' => '',
'clientSecret' => '',
'enabled' => false,
]);
$this->assertSame(
200,
$response['headers']['status-code'],
'OAuth2 reset failed — downstream tests will be unreliable. Body: ' . \json_encode($response['body'] ?? null),
);
}
// =========================================================================
// List OAuth2 providers
// =========================================================================
public function testListOAuth2Providers(): void
{
$response = $this->listOAuth2Providers();
$this->assertSame(200, $response['headers']['status-code']);
$this->assertArrayHasKey('total', $response['body']);
$this->assertArrayHasKey('providers', $response['body']);
$this->assertGreaterThan(0, $response['body']['total']);
$this->assertSame($response['body']['total'], \count($response['body']['providers']));
}

// =========================================================================
// Update OIDC (clientId + secret + wellKnownURL or 3 discovery URLs)
// =========================================================================
public function testUpdateOAuth2OidcWithWellKnown(): void
{
$response = $this->updateOAuth2('oidc', [
'clientId' => 'oidc-client',
'clientSecret' => 'oidc-secret',
'wellKnownURL' => 'https://idp.example.com/.well-known/openid-configuration',
'enabled' => false,
]);
$this->assertSame(200, $response['headers']['status-code']);
$this->assertSame('https://idp.example.com/.well-known/openid-configuration', $response['body']['wellKnownURL']);
$this->assertArrayHasKey('authorizationURL', $response['body']);
$this->assertArrayHasKey('tokenURL', $response['body']);
$this->assertArrayHasKey('userInfoURL', $response['body']);
// Cleanup
$this->updateOAuth2('oidc', [
'clientId' => '',
'clientSecret' => '',
'wellKnownURL' => '',
'authorizationURL' => '',
'tokenURL' => '',
'userInfoURL' => '',
'enabled' => false,
]);
}
public function testUpdateOAuth2OidcWithDiscoveryURLs(): void
{
$response = $this->updateOAuth2('oidc', [
'clientId' => 'oidc-discovery',
'clientSecret' => 'oidc-discovery-secret',
'authorizationURL' => 'https://idp.example.com/oauth2/authorize',
'tokenURL' => 'https://idp.example.com/oauth2/token',
'userInfoURL' => 'https://idp.example.com/oauth2/userinfo',
'enabled' => false,
]);
$this->assertSame(200, $response['headers']['status-code']);
$this->assertSame('https://idp.example.com/oauth2/authorize', $response['body']['authorizationURL']);
$this->assertSame('https://idp.example.com/oauth2/token', $response['body']['tokenURL']);
$this->assertSame('https://idp.example.com/oauth2/userinfo', $response['body']['userInfoURL']);
// Cleanup
$this->updateOAuth2('oidc', [
'clientId' => '',
'clientSecret' => '',
'wellKnownURL' => '',
'authorizationURL' => '',
'tokenURL' => '',
'userInfoURL' => '',
'enabled' => false,
]);
}
public function testUpdateOAuth2OidcEnableMissingURLs(): void
{
$this->updateOAuth2('oidc', [
'clientId' => '',
'clientSecret' => '',
'wellKnownURL' => '',
'authorizationURL' => '',
'tokenURL' => '',
'userInfoURL' => '',
'enabled' => false,
]);
$response = $this->updateOAuth2('oidc', [
'clientId' => 'oidc-no-urls',
'clientSecret' => 'oidc-no-urls',
'enabled' => true,
]);
$this->assertSame(400, $response['headers']['status-code']);
$this->assertSame('general_argument_invalid', $response['body']['type']);
// Cleanup
$this->updateOAuth2('oidc', [
'clientId' => '',
'clientSecret' => '',
'enabled' => false,
]);
}
public function testUpdateOAuth2OidcEnablePartialDiscoveryFails(): void
{
// Only authorization+token, missing userInfo — must fail to enable.
$this->updateOAuth2('oidc', [
'clientId' => '',
'clientSecret' => '',
'wellKnownURL' => '',
'authorizationURL' => '',
'tokenURL' => '',
'userInfoURL' => '',
'enabled' => false,
]);
$response = $this->updateOAuth2('oidc', [
'clientId' => 'oidc-partial',
'clientSecret' => 'oidc-partial-secret',
'authorizationURL' => 'https://idp.example.com/oauth2/authorize',
'tokenURL' => 'https://idp.example.com/oauth2/token',
'enabled' => true,
]);
$this->assertSame(400, $response['headers']['status-code']);
$this->assertSame('general_argument_invalid', $response['body']['type']);
// Cleanup
$this->updateOAuth2('oidc', [
'clientId' => '',
'clientSecret' => '',
'wellKnownURL' => '',
'authorizationURL' => '',
'tokenURL' => '',
'userInfoURL' => '',
'enabled' => false,
]);
}
public function testUpdateOAuth2OidcEnableSucceedsWithWellKnown(): void
{
$update = $this->updateOAuth2('oidc', [
'clientId' => 'oidc-enable-client',
'clientSecret' => 'oidc-enable-secret',
'wellKnownURL' => 'https://idp.example.com/.well-known/openid-configuration',
'enabled' => true,
]);
$this->assertSame(200, $update['headers']['status-code']);
$this->assertTrue($update['body']['enabled']);
// GET must hide clientSecret while keeping clientId and the URL.
$get = $this->getOAuth2Provider('oidc');
$this->assertSame(200, $get['headers']['status-code']);
$this->assertTrue($get['body']['enabled']);
$this->assertSame('oidc-enable-client', $get['body']['clientId']);
$this->assertSame('https://idp.example.com/.well-known/openid-configuration', $get['body']['wellKnownURL']);
$this->assertSame('', $get['body']['clientSecret']);
// Cleanup
$this->updateOAuth2('oidc', [
'clientId' => '',
'clientSecret' => '',
'wellKnownURL' => '',
'authorizationURL' => '',
'tokenURL' => '',
'userInfoURL' => '',
'enabled' => false,
]);
}
public function testUpdateOAuth2OidcEnableInSeparateRequestWithWellKnown(): void
{
// Configure URLs first with `enabled: false`. Then enable in a SECOND
// request that omits all URL fields. The merge-on-enable logic in
// Oidc::handle() must see the previously-stored wellKnownEndpoint and
// allow the toggle. This is the headline feature of the merge logic.
$this->updateOAuth2('oidc', [
'clientId' => 'oidc-split-wk-client',
'clientSecret' => 'oidc-split-wk-secret',
'wellKnownURL' => 'https://idp.example.com/.well-known/openid-configuration',
'enabled' => false,
]);
$enable = $this->updateOAuth2('oidc', [
'enabled' => true,
]);
$this->assertSame(200, $enable['headers']['status-code']);
$this->assertTrue($enable['body']['enabled']);
// Cleanup
$this->updateOAuth2('oidc', [
'clientId' => '',
'clientSecret' => '',
'wellKnownURL' => '',
'authorizationURL' => '',
'tokenURL' => '',
'userInfoURL' => '',
'enabled' => false,
]);
}
public function testUpdateOAuth2OidcEnableAcrossRequestsWithDiscoveryURLs(): void
{
// Reset to clean state — earlier tests in this section may have left
// partial URL state when running in any order.
$this->updateOAuth2('oidc', [
'clientId' => '',
'clientSecret' => '',
'wellKnownURL' => '',
'authorizationURL' => '',
'tokenURL' => '',
'userInfoURL' => '',
'enabled' => false,
]);
// Request 1: configure two of the three discovery URLs.
$this->updateOAuth2('oidc', [
'clientId' => 'oidc-split-discovery',
'clientSecret' => 'oidc-split-discovery-secret',
'authorizationURL' => 'https://idp.example.com/oauth2/authorize',
'tokenURL' => 'https://idp.example.com/oauth2/token',
'enabled' => false,
]);
// Request 2: send only the third URL plus enable=true. The merged
// state must include the two stored URLs + the new one to satisfy
// the all-three-discovery-URLs branch of the enable check.
$enable = $this->updateOAuth2('oidc', [
'userInfoURL' => 'https://idp.example.com/oauth2/userinfo',
'enabled' => true,
]);
$this->assertSame(200, $enable['headers']['status-code']);
$this->assertTrue($enable['body']['enabled']);
// Confirm all three URLs ended up persisted (merge wrote the new
// userInfoURL while preserving the previously stored two).
$get = $this->getOAuth2Provider('oidc');
$this->assertSame(200, $get['headers']['status-code']);
$this->assertSame('https://idp.example.com/oauth2/authorize', $get['body']['authorizationURL']);
$this->assertSame('https://idp.example.com/oauth2/token', $get['body']['tokenURL']);
$this->assertSame('https://idp.example.com/oauth2/userinfo', $get['body']['userInfoURL']);
// Cleanup
$this->updateOAuth2('oidc', [
'clientId' => '',
'clientSecret' => '',
'wellKnownURL' => '',
'authorizationURL' => '',
'tokenURL' => '',
'userInfoURL' => '',
'enabled' => false,
]);
}
public function testUpdateOAuth2OidcEnableFailsAfterClearingWellKnown(): void
{
// Seed wellKnownURL only (no discovery URLs).
$this->updateOAuth2('oidc', [
'clientId' => 'oidc-clear-then-enable',
'clientSecret' => 'oidc-clear-then-enable-secret',
'wellKnownURL' => 'https://idp.example.com/.well-known/openid-configuration',
'authorizationURL' => '',
'tokenURL' => '',
'userInfoURL' => '',
'enabled' => false,
]);
// Clear wellKnownURL and try to enable in the same request. Merge
// sees `wellKnown=''` (the cleared empty wins over the stored value
// because the new value is non-null) and no discovery URLs → 400.
// This is the inverse of testUpdateOAuth2OidcEnableInSeparateRequestWithWellKnown:
// confirms the merge correctly *replaces* with empty rather than
// falling back to the stored non-empty value.
$response = $this->updateOAuth2('oidc', [
'wellKnownURL' => '',
'enabled' => true,
]);
$this->assertSame(400, $response['headers']['status-code']);
$this->assertSame('general_argument_invalid', $response['body']['type']);
// Cleanup
$this->updateOAuth2('oidc', [
'clientId' => '',
'clientSecret' => '',
'wellKnownURL' => '',
'authorizationURL' => '',
'tokenURL' => '',
'userInfoURL' => '',
'enabled' => false,
]);
}
public function testUpdateOAuth2OidcSwitchModesWellKnownToDiscovery(): void
{
// Configure with wellKnownURL, then switch to the three-discovery-URL
// mode in a single request: clear wellKnown, set the three URLs,
// enable. Merge sees wellKnown='' AND all three discovery URLs set →
// hasAllDiscovery branch passes.
$this->updateOAuth2('oidc', [
'clientId' => 'oidc-switch-client',
'clientSecret' => 'oidc-switch-secret',
'wellKnownURL' => 'https://idp.example.com/.well-known/openid-configuration',
'enabled' => false,
]);
$switch = $this->updateOAuth2('oidc', [
'wellKnownURL' => '',
'authorizationURL' => 'https://idp.example.com/oauth2/authorize',
'tokenURL' => 'https://idp.example.com/oauth2/token',
'userInfoURL' => 'https://idp.example.com/oauth2/userinfo',
'enabled' => true,
]);
$this->assertSame(200, $switch['headers']['status-code']);
$this->assertTrue($switch['body']['enabled']);
$this->assertSame('', $switch['body']['wellKnownURL']);
$this->assertSame('https://idp.example.com/oauth2/authorize', $switch['body']['authorizationURL']);
$this->assertSame('https://idp.example.com/oauth2/token', $switch['body']['tokenURL']);
$this->assertSame('https://idp.example.com/oauth2/userinfo', $switch['body']['userInfoURL']);
// Cleanup
$this->updateOAuth2('oidc', [
'clientId' => '',
'clientSecret' => '',
'wellKnownURL' => '',
'authorizationURL' => '',
'tokenURL' => '',
'userInfoURL' => '',
'enabled' => false,
]);
}

// =========================================================================
// Smoke test: every plain (clientId + clientSecret) provider
//
// Ensures each provider's Update endpoint is wired up correctly: routing,
// provider class, response model and `$id`. Custom-shaped providers
// (apple, auth0, authentik, fusionauth, gitlab, keycloak, microsoft, oidc,
// okta, dropbox) and sandboxes (paypalSandbox, tradeshiftSandbox) have
// dedicated tests above.
// Github is excluded because its `verifyCredentials()` hook is exercised
// separately.
// =========================================================================
/**
* Provider, ID-field, secret-field. Many providers rename one or both of
* the two credential params (`clientId`/`clientSecret`) to match the
* upstream provider's terminology, so the smoke test parameterises both.
*
* @return array<string, array<string>>
*/
public static function plainProviders(): array
{
return [
'discord' => ['discord', 'clientId', 'clientSecret'],
'figma' => ['figma', 'clientId', 'clientSecret'],
'dailymotion' => ['dailymotion', 'apiKey', 'apiSecret'],
'bitbucket' => ['bitbucket', 'key', 'secret'],
'bitly' => ['bitly', 'clientId', 'clientSecret'],
'box' => ['box', 'clientId', 'clientSecret'],
'autodesk' => ['autodesk', 'clientId', 'clientSecret'],
'google' => ['google', 'clientId', 'clientSecret'],
'zoom' => ['zoom', 'clientId', 'clientSecret'],
'zoho' => ['zoho', 'clientId', 'clientSecret'],
'yandex' => ['yandex', 'clientId', 'clientSecret'],
'x' => ['x', 'customerKey', 'secretKey'],
'wordpress' => ['wordpress', 'clientId', 'clientSecret'],
'twitch' => ['twitch', 'clientId', 'clientSecret'],
'stripe' => ['stripe', 'clientId', 'apiSecretKey'],
'spotify' => ['spotify', 'clientId', 'clientSecret'],
'slack' => ['slack', 'clientId', 'clientSecret'],
'podio' => ['podio', 'clientId', 'clientSecret'],
'notion' => ['notion', 'oauthClientId', 'oauthClientSecret'],
'salesforce' => ['salesforce', 'customerKey', 'customerSecret'],
'yahoo' => ['yahoo', 'clientId', 'clientSecret'],
'linkedin' => ['linkedin', 'clientId', 'primaryClientSecret'],
'disqus' => ['disqus', 'publicKey', 'secretKey'],
'etsy' => ['etsy', 'keyString', 'sharedSecret'],
'facebook' => ['facebook', 'appId', 'appSecret'],
'tradeshift' => ['tradeshift', 'oauth2ClientId', 'oauth2ClientSecret'],
'paypal' => ['paypal', 'clientId', 'secretKey'],
'kick' => ['kick', 'clientId', 'clientSecret'],
];
}
#[DataProvider('plainProviders')]
public function testUpdateOAuth2PlainProvider(string $providerId, string $idField, string $secretField): void
{
$clientId = $providerId . '-smoke-client';
$clientSecret = $providerId . '-smoke-secret';
$update = $this->updateOAuth2($providerId, [
$idField => $clientId,
$secretField => $clientSecret,
'enabled' => false,
]);
$this->assertSame(200, $update['headers']['status-code']);
$this->assertSame($providerId, $update['body']['$id']);
$this->assertSame($clientId, $update['body'][$idField]);
$this->assertFalse($update['body']['enabled']);
// GET round-trip — confirms the value actually persisted (catches a
// PATCH that only echoes input without writing) and that the secret
// is hidden on read.
$get = $this->getOAuth2Provider($providerId);
$this->assertSame(200, $get['headers']['status-code']);
$this->assertSame($providerId, $get['body']['$id']);
$this->assertSame($clientId, $get['body'][$idField]);
$this->assertSame('', $get['body'][$secretField]);
$this->assertFalse($get['body']['enabled']);
// Cleanup
$this->updateOAuth2($providerId, [
$idField => '',
$secretField => '',
'enabled' => false,
]);
}
